What is Coconut Coir Peat?
Coconut coir peat is a natural, renewable by-product derived from the fibrous husks of coconuts. This eco-friendly material is produced during the processing of coconuts, where the outer layer, known as the coir, is separated from the fruit. The resulting coir peat possesses unique properties that distinguished it from traditional peat moss, primarily found in bogs and wetlands. While conventional peat moss is sourced from decomposed sphagnum moss and is known for its ability to retain moisture, coir peat offers a sustainable alternative, showcasing similar water retention capabilities but with additional ecological benefits.
The composition of coconut coir peat predominantly consists of fiber, pith, and dust, which together create a lightweight, spongy structure. This fibrous texture not only enhances aeration in the soil but also promotes healthy root development in plants, making it a favorable medium for both horticultural and agricultural applications. Additionally, coir peat's pH-neutral characteristics render it suitable for a variety of plants, allowing it to adapt seamlessly to different growing conditions. Its versatility extends across various gardening practices, including container gardening, seed starting, and hydroponics, proving to be an invaluable resource for both amateur and professional gardeners.

The Process of Making Coconut Coir Peat
The production of coconut coir peat involves several meticulous steps, starting with the harvesting of coconuts. During this initial stage, matured coconuts are collected from palm trees, typically in tropical regions where coconut trees thrive. Once harvested, the coconuts are husked, separating the tough outer shell from the inner fruit. This husk, predominantly made of fibrous material, is the primary source of coir.
After husking, the next phase is the soaking of the coir fibers. This process typically takes place in large water bodies or tanks, where the husks are submerged for several days to facilitate the separation of the fibers from the pith. This soaking not only aids in extracting the fibers but also helps in breaking down any remaining pulp, thereby optimizing the quality of the coir peat. Following this, the fibers undergo a thorough washing process to remove any impurities, such as salts and residual organic matter, enhancing their suitability for horticultural applications.
The drying and shredding of coir follow washing. Here, the cleaned coir fibers are dried using natural sunlight or mechanical methods, reducing moisture content to ensure longer shelf life and better handling during packaging. Once dried, the coir is shredded into finer particles, allowing for uniformity in texture. The resulting coir peat can absorb moisture and provide excellent aeration for plant roots, which is why it is highly sought after in gardening and agriculture.
Lastly, the coir peat is packaged for export. It is typically compressed into bales or bricks, which facilitate economical transport while preserving its quality. Environmental Benefits of Coconut Coir Peat
Coconut coir peat has emerged as a remarkable sustainable solution in horticulture and agriculture, largely attributed to its environmental benefits. One of the primary advantages of coir peat is its exceptional water retention capacity. By effectively holding moisture, it ensures that plants receive a consistent supply of water, which is crucial for optimal growth. This characteristic makes coconut coir peat a superior alternative to synthetic soil amendments that often fail to provide adequate hydration. Additionally, its fibrous structure enhances soil aeration, allowing roots to access oxygen more easily. Improved aeration further fosters a robust root system, which is essential for healthy plant development.
